La restauración de la Marisma Gallega (Parque Natural de Doñana): efectos en las características superficiales del suelo

Authors: García, Luis V.; Gutiérrez González, Eduardo; Espinar, José L.; Cara García, Juan S.; Jordán, A.; Clemente Salas, Luis;

La restauración de la Marisma Gallega (Parque Natural de Doñana): efectos en las características superficiales del suelo

Abstract

[ES]: Se estudia el efecto de las obras de regeneración en diversas características de los suelos de zonas elevadas (relativamente poco inundables) de la Marisma Gallega, en el Parque Natural de Doñana. Se trata de suelos típicos de la marisma salina del Guadalquivir (pesados, carbonatados y salino-sódicos) que fueron, en parte, sometidos a la retirada del horizonte superficial para rellenar el sistema de canales de drenaje construido durante los intentos de puesta en cultivo de la zona, a principios de los años 70. Como resultado de estas obras se generó una superficie considerable de zonas con el suelo decapitado y vegetación destruida (zonas de préstamo o arrastre), junto a un conjunto de canales rellenados (zonas de relleno).

[EN]: We studied the effect of restoration practices on 17 soil variables on river banks of a wetland located next to the Doñana National Park (SW Spain). At the beginning of the 70s, this area had been partially drained for agricultural uses, by digging open channels. During the 2000-2001 dry seasons (June-October), most of the channels were filled by bulldozers, using the topsoil of the surrounding natural areas as filling materials. Three different kinds of topsoil material are compared: that of sites unaffected by restoration practices (control); that of dug sites (whose topsoil had been removed, exposing the underlying horizons), and that of refilled channels.
